scraping duckduckgo 4

Duckduckgo Api Getting Search Results


scraping duckduckgo

Your proxy provider will likely get upset if you get too lots of their proxies blacklisted, so it’s finest to stop scraping with that proxy IP earlier than this occurs. If you proceed a new scrape with that IP, which Google has now flagged, it’ll likely get banned from Google, after which blacklisted. Google and different engines want humans to look the web, not bots. So, if your bot doesn’t act like a human, you’ll get booted. But you’re here, on a proxy website, looking for the best engine to scrape, so you most likely have a clue.
I wouldn’t be stunned if they have a way to embed search on varied platforms. Newest duckduckgo questions feed To subscribe to this RSS feed, copy and paste this URL into your RSS reader. If the classes outlined above don’t be just right for you i.e. they’re returning empty results, please refer the guide to discovering the right selectors.

How Does Googlescraper Maximize The Amount Of Extracted Information Per Ip Address?

I also anticipate that you are acquainted with the basics of the Java language and have Java eight installed on your machine. With internet scraping, you can’t creating an effective b2b data driven marketing campaign only automate the method but additionally scale the process to deal with as many web sites as your computing assets can enable.
Yahoo! has a decrease threshold than Google, however not necessarily one that allows you quick access. You can try, but make sure to take action cautiously if you’re apprehensive about your proxies. Set threads to low and timeouts excessive, and build up from there.

A Python3 Library For Searching Using The Duckduckgo Api And Full Search Via Browser

The web site has an built-in 2captcha distant captcha fixing service for uninterrupted scraping and will bypass most types of captchas together with Google recaptcha model 2 and three. “Google Still World’s Most Popular Search Engine By Far, But Share Of Unique Searchers Dips Slightly”. cURL – a commandline browser for automation and testing in addition to a powerful open source HTTP interplay library out there for a large range of programming languages.
However, there are some Web links inside it, e.g. official websites. What I wish to do is simply submitting string queries and saving the URL of the primary results . Google has a close to seventy three% market share and has held the primary website rating for the past few years, occasionally flip-flopping with tech rival Facebook.
And you copy this and then re-publish this JSON verbatim on your web site without my permission, it’s copyright infringement as you’re copying how I represented this public truth. However, should you simply write “the sky is blue” on your website or re-construction this information format, you might be within the clear since you’re merely re-publishing a public reality alone . This clearly violates the right to access guideline, even when the data is technically “publicly obtainable” but requires a clever “hack” to obtain. Just observe these 2 simple guidelines and 99% of the time you’ll be operating in the spirit of the legislation and following business finest-practices. Of course, this isn’t the final resting place for this data, you can retailer it in a database and render it on an app or one other web site and even serve it on an API to be displayed on a Chrome Extension.
It doesn’t support XPath-primarily based parsing and is beginner pleasant. These are a number of the methods net scraping can be used and how it can have an effect on the operations of a company.
The tool from is a particularly helpful software, which might save plenty of time, money, and efforts of the customers. This software program collects the information from a mother or father site in an organized method along with copies data as per the requirement of a consumer. So we opened IE, navigated to DuckDuckGo, carried out a search, parsed the outcomes on the web web web page, printed them to Excel, and even did some additional analysis on the retrieved information. All that’s left is to close (.Quit) the browser object and end the procedure.
She also take pleasure in cycling across London on an iconic Boris bike that has come to outline London. You are most probably to stumble upon Tanya in Brick Lane or Camden Town where she enjoys spending most of her time.

scraping duckduckgo

Topic: Duckduckgo Isn’T Who You Think They Are  (Read 1437 Times)

VBA is almost similar to Visual Basic, a common programming language for creating .exe Windows programs. But we love Excel for its myriad business uses… parsing, sorting, presenting, and storing data… so I discover myself programming inside Excel/VBA by default. See if your application can handle it, and what kind of results you get.
Various on-line instruments are accessible for knowledge scraping that makes the information mining work quite convenient. This device equipped by would assist the purchasers to extract useful information from numerous Google pages just like Google web, Google photos, Google News, Google movies, Google blogs, and so forth. When the information will get scraped with Google scraping instruments, the info as well as corresponding data are saved in numerous databases like MS Access, MS Excel, and MySQL, and so on. By technique of doing so, a person would have immense information from the Google database, which might be utilized in enterprise purposes to help the enterprise develop exponentially. This easy software program is used to scrap URLS from google search finish end result internet page.

Some organizations use web scraping for market analysis the place they extract information about their products and in addition opponents. The data extracted is extra accurate and uniformly formatted making certain consistency. In this publish, we are going to explore net scraping utilizing the Java language.
During her spare time, Elena take pleasure in horse using, camping and hiking, interior design and maintaining abreast with the most recent developments. Elena is in the process of starting up her own beauty cosmetics line within the near future. Elena can also be a contributing author to fashion and life-style magazines and has been featured in Vice, Country Living, Harrods journal, Daily Telegraph, Grazia and Women’s Health. Tatyana enjoys pursuing her flare for creativity by way of modelling, graffiti artwork, astronomy and expertise.

The Only Lead Generation

Search engine scraping is the method of harvesting URLs, descriptions, or other information from search engines similar to Google, Bing or Yahoo. This is a particular type of display display screen scraping or web scraping dedicated to search engines solely. Google web site scraper software is an web gadget, which may make the information scraping, copying in addition to manipulating job very straightforward for the person.
It lets you discover out your reply with none further click and has a fantastic position in time and power saving. It is value mentioning that as quickly as featured snippets of Google were created, no-click on searches increased considerably.
It helps a wide range of totally different search engines and is rather more surroundings pleasant than GoogleScraper. The code base could be much less superior with out threading/queueing and complex logging capabilities. GoogleScraper – A Python module to scrape different search engines like google and yahoo by using proxies (socks4/5, http proxy). The software includes asynchronous networking help and is ready to control real browsers to mitigate detection.
For every aEle we find, we’ll copy its href value over to a string variable known as result, then print the string to the Excel sheet. Ok, I admit we don’t really want this –we might just print aEle’s value to the sheet directly– but I added it to introduce you to string variables. Think of variables as floating references or containers that refer to objects or numbers we wish to manipulate. But before we get to make use of them, we now have to declare, or Dim, them, which units apart some reminiscence for no matter type of use we have in mind for them.

  • You can then use the scraped sales leads for all forms of B2B advertising corresponding to e mail blasts, newsletters, telesales and social media campaigns.
  • As a wholesaler, your sole objective is to promote to other businesses.
  • The CBT lead generation software program is a bridge that can connect you to your B2B prospects.
  • For instance, if you are a Hemp and CBD firm, you could need to scrape information for cosmetics and sweetness, sports nutrition and vitamin outlets after which contact them with your wholesale hemp and CBD products.

It helps scraping from a number of search pages and then save the data proper into a CSV file. Turns out, primary web scraping, routinely grabbing data from websites, is feasible proper in your Google Sheet, with out having to write down any code.
Are you seeking to enhance your wholesale sales and take your business to a different degree? Generate your individual sales leads free of charge and say goodbye to expensive advertising lists. For instance, if you are a Hemp and CBD company, you might want to scrape information for cosmetics and wonder, sports activities diet and vitamin shops and then contact them with your wholesale hemp and CBD merchandise. As a wholesaler, your sole goal is to promote to other businesses.
Search engines cannot easily be tricked by changing to a different IP, while using proxies is a very important half in successful scraping. The diversity and abusive history of an IP is necessary as properly. The process of coming into an internet site and extracting information in an automated trend is also typically referred to as “crawling”. Search engines like Google, Bing or Yahoo get virtually all their data from automated crawling bots.

Duckduckgo Reports

scraping duckduckgo
See our How Does DuckDuckGo Make Money tutorial for further information. GitHub is residence to over 50 million builders working together to host and review 100 common email spam trigger words and phrases to avoid code, handle projects, and build software collectively.
Sometimes it’s a lot simpler to look at a video than read a lot of content material. If you determine to embed Youtube, Soundcloud, Vimeo, or any other video content into your web site, it may be listed by some internet crawlers. Social media crawling is kind of an interesting matter as not all social media platforms permit to be crawled.
Ekaterina’s different interest include swimming, painting, touring, purchasing, spending a great time with her pals and helping animals in need. In her spare time, Nataly enjoys early morning jogs, fitness, meditation, wine tasting, touring and spending high quality time together with her pals. Nataly can also be an avid classic automotive collector and is at present engaged on her 1993 W124 Mercedes. Nataly is a contributing author to many CBD magazines and blogs. She has been featured in prominent media outlets corresponding to Cosmopolitan, Elle, Grazia, Women’s Health, The Guardian and others.
No want to train customers how it features as is designed as simple as Google. All-SERP as a buyer-focused company does all its best to supply high quality SERP scraping instruments to simplify an advanced process for our honored shoppers at best possible costs. Without API, Google can not understand your vacation spot and in addition can not show the result to you. API helps functions and software to be related with one another. This brief however precise and helpful answer makes it pointless to click on any website to get data.
Featured snippets present a fast, quick however helpful reply to the user. The quality of a web site’s content as well as many other components immediately influence the rating process. The first website how to scrape and extract data from your website list appeared on the highest of the primary web page of Google has the very best rank and the ranking of other websites lower respectively. These firms make money off you and many sites complain should you use ad blocker.
The CBT lead technology software program is a bridge that will join you to your B2B prospects. The CBT website scraper and email extractor will allow you to generate area of interest focused gross sales leads immediately into an Excel spreadsheet file on a whole auto pilot. Simply enter your key phrases, configure your settings and watch the magic occur! You can then use the scraped sales leads for all forms of B2B advertising corresponding to email blasts, newsletters, telesales and social media campaigns. Compunect scraping sourcecode – A vary of properly-known open supply PHP scraping scripts together with a regularly maintained Google Search scraper for scraping ads and natural resultpages.
GoogleScraper – A Python module to scrape utterly different search engines like google by using proxies (socks4/5, http proxy). Google search finish result scraper is a software program software that allows you to extract the search end outcome listing from the Google search engine web site. A totally custom-made, a quick, dependable answer that matches with your corporation wants. The information extraction approach is used to scrape info from varied sites on the internet and then analyzing knowledge to derive helpful outcomes.
To manipulate Internet Explorer as an object in VBA, we need to Dim the browser — both generically as an Object variable , or extra particularly as an InternetExplorer particular object variable like we did here . Author Bio

About the Author: Giorgia is a blogger at weedupdate, veteranhempco and primecbd.

Contacts:

Facebook

Twitter

Instagram

LinkedIn

Email

Telephone:Telephone: 020 3394 0152

Address: 2453 Lyell RoadRochester, New York

Published Articles:

Guest post

As Featured in

http://www.wsj.com/
http://bloomberg.com/
https://www.womansday.com/
http://hollywoodreporter.com/
https://www.standard.co.ukNo special cause, apart from making it straightforward to recollect what it’s for. Names of variables could be nearly anything you need, and camelCase with first letter lowercase is the same old naming conference. In some respects they’re easier, and for 99% of internet automation tasksg, you really can’t go mistaken with either. But I obtained to the place I only used VBA as a result of my programming was moving into Windows API’s and command line calls , plus I usually found myself utilizing Excel alongside these packages anyway.

I discovered there’s almost nothing VBA can’t do with automating Windows and Internet Explorer , and it seemed to me investing time studying Microsoft’s Visual Basic programming language simply made extra sense. VBA exists inside Word, Access, Outlook, Publisher, and other Microsoft merchandise, too.

You also needs to bear in mind that such kind of crawling could be unlawful if it violates information privacy compliance. Still, there are lots of social media platform suppliers which might be fine with crawling. For instance, Pinterest and Twitter permit spider bots to scan their pages if they are not person-delicate and do not disclose any personal information.
With the advent of the Internet, news from all around the world could be unfold quickly around the Web, and to extract knowledge from varied web sites can be fairly unmanageable. Indeed, you don’t perform searches in the World Wide Web however in a search index and that is when an internet crawler enters the battlefield. Before plunging into the details of how a crawler robotic works, let’s see how the entire search process is executed before you get an answer to your search query. I was writing “embed” in double quotes as a result of it is not precisely embedding with an iframe in a website or something.

The alternatives are a lot and it is as much as you to determine what you want to do with the info. At the top of the file, we import IOException and some JSoup courses that can assist us parse knowledge. To obtain this, we need to open the CodeTriage web site and choose Java Language on a browser and inspect the HTML code using Dev tools. Even although there are APIs available that provide this data, I discover it an excellent instance to be taught or apply net scraping with. JSoup – this is a easy open-supply library that gives very handy functionality for extracting and manipulating information by utilizing DOM traversal or CSS selectors to search out data.
All these types of detection may also occur to a standard user, especially customers sharing the same IP handle or community class . The third layer of defense is a longterm block of the whole community segment. This kind of block is probably going triggered by an administrator and solely occurs if a scraping software is sending a very excessive number of requests. Network and IP limitations are as nicely a part of the scraping defense methods.
Update the next settings within the GoogleScraper configuration file scrape_config.py to your values. You are prone to see Ekaterina in front of her souped up Alienware laptop computer gaming or delving into the world of Cryptocurrency. Ekaterina additionally boasts a very giant collection of Penny Black Posts stamps and silver hammered Medieval cash.

I give Automate the Web permission to collect and use my information submitted in this form. Now we increment y by 1, so each new end result discovered shall be printed on the next row down. Setting an object instantiates or activates a brand new instance of its object sort. So we’re saying let’s start a new occasion of the IE browser.

scraping duckduckgo
When you don’t find what you need merely redo the search standards. Scraping with low level http libraries similar to urllib.request or requests modules. The outcomes could be inspected within the file Outputs/advertising.json.
scraping duckduckgo